WATCH: Secret Service arrests activist for vandalizing Trump Tower

On Wednesday, a climate activist was arrested by Secret Service after vandalizing the gold Trump Tower placard with chalk spray paint.

The climate activist who belongs to the group "Extinction Rebellion" walked into Trump Tower in Manhattan, then sprayed "USA" over the Presidential placard.

He knelt, and Secret Service shortly approached him and arrested him.
 


Extinction Rebellion also published a press release following the demonstration:

"I did this because I am an American. It is my duty t ostand up for my country, and my Earth, when a government becomes destructive of our right to Life."
 

The man continued, "Donald Trump and the regime of private interests he works for—who donate equally to each party—are destructive of your inaIienable right to Life. All American political parties are equally complicit in inaction which has brought us to this point."

The man made it a point to state that it did not matter whether the U.S. is governed by Republians or Democrats.

He said, "Switching to blue is not the solve. Kamala Harris' climate platform was fracked gas, much deadlier than regular."

Secret Service spokesperson James Byrne made a statement: "The U.S. Secret Service is aware of an incident involving a person spray painting graffiti  inside the public lobby of Trump Tower in New York City. There are no disruptions to protective operations. We thank the NYPD for their immediate response and unwavering partnership."
